重庆分公司,新征程启航
为企业提供网站建设、域名注册、服务器等服务
猜测你说的是 主键 primary key 不能为空 。数据库都是这样。区分两条记录必须要通过key。可以是唯一的key 就是主键 或者是组合的 key(姓+名) 联合主键 。
创新互联公司坚持“要么做到,要么别承诺”的工作理念,服务领域包括:网站建设、成都网站制作、企业官网、英文网站、手机端网站、网站推广等服务,满足客户于互联网时代的福山网站设计、移动媒体设计的需求,帮助企业找到有效的互联网解决方案。努力成为您成熟可靠的网络建设合作伙伴!
mysql建表时如果要设置自动递增(auto_increment),必须是主键(PRIMARY KEY)设置,不能为NULL,且只能设置一个。
MySQL建表,字段需设置为非空,需设置字段默认值。 MySQL建表,字段需NULL时,需设置字段默认值,默认值不为NULL。 MySQL建表,如果字段等价于外键,应在该字段加索引。
1、update tblname set 字段=null where condition; 直接用常量Null。这个是有条件限制的。
2、执行SQL语句:update tablename set C=null where A=2 tablebname是这张表的表名 C和A是字段。
3、语法如下:update table set col_name=null where id=1 数据表 table的字段 col_name 需要支持为NULL才能正常执行。延展阅读:Update是一个数据库SQL语法用语,用途是更新表中原有数据,单独使用时使用where匹配字段。
1、MySQL建表,字段需设置为非空,需设置字段默认值。 MySQL建表,字段需NULL时,需设置字段默认值,默认值不为NULL。 MySQL建表,如果字段等价于外键,应在该字段加索引。
2、主键列不允许空值,而唯一性索引列允许空值。
3、唯一键约束是通过参考索引实施的,如果插入的值均为NULL,则根据索引的原理,全NULL值不被记录在索引上,所以插入全NULL值时,可以有重复的,而其他的则不能插入重复值。
MySQL默认采用的是MyISAM,MyISAM不支持事务,而InnoDB支持。
describe 表名 是 show columns from 表名 的一种快捷方式。修改mysql数据库密码 方法一:使用phpmyadmin,直接修改Mysql库的user 表。或者使用Navicat for Mysql 直接修改连接属性。
创建一个表只需要数分钟,尤其是如果你只要存储几项不同的条目。下文将教你如何创建表。部分1:创建表打开数据库。想要创建一个表,你必须先有一个存储表的数据库。你可以在MySQL命令行键入USE库名,打开数据库。
首先要选择在哪个数据库建表,这里的数据库是指自己电脑中mysql的数据库。
MySQL可以很好的支持大数据量的存取,但是一般说来,数据库中的表越小,在它上面执行的查询也就会越快因此,在创建表的时候,为了获得更好的性能,我们可以将表中字段的宽度设得尽可能小。